The Norwegian Port of Bergen has received NOK 1.7 mln (EUR approx. 191 thou.) from the State Coastal Authority for a new time savings cargo data information system.
The project, worth in total NOK 4 mln (EUR 450 thou.), aims at time rationalization of time thanks to a shift from manual incoming cargo registration, into a digital system, which will reduce the number of errors.
